Green Monster Icefall Hike: A Winter Hiking Adventure in Kananaskis Country
Green Monster Icefall is a winter only hike tucked along Evan Thomas Creek in Kananaskis Country. This seasonal adventure leads through frozen creek corridors and past smaller icefalls before reaching the towering emerald tinted waterfall known as the Green Monster. With exposure, chains, and shared use with ice climbers, this hike asks for presence, preparation, and respect. It is a powerful reminder that winter holds its own quiet magic when we choose to lean into it.
